    Some of them have a cover when in attics that can get real cold or hot. Studor is allowed in areas from -40 to +150 degrees Fahrenheit and with a cover above or below those temps, and can go outside. The Sure Vent is only used indoors, and in the -40 to +150 degree range. And, the AHJ might have stricter requirements.
